Pharisaic (Adjective)

Meaning

Excessively or hypocritically pious; "a sickening sanctimonious smile".

Examples

  • The televangelist's pharisaic speeches, full of false humility and righteousness, alienated many viewers.
  • His self-serving declarations of faith struck many as pharisaic, masking his own greed and ambition.
  • She grew tired of her neighbor's pharisaic complaints about her gardening, especially given his own well-manicured lawn.
  • The politician's pharisaic responses to allegations of corruption were transparent and ultimately hurt her reputation.
  • His public outbursts against the arts seemed pharisaic to some, an attempt to disguise his own shallow cultural tastes.

Synonyms

  • Self-righteous
  • Holier-than-thou
  • Pharisaical
  • Pietistic
  • Pietistical
  • Sanctimonious
